Yes. Hurricanes can cause flooding, landslides, and tornadoes, though normally these effects are considered part of the natural disaster of the hurricane itself. There are cases of less direct effects:
In 1991 a storm near the U.S. east coast absorbed the remnants of Hurricane Grace, intensifying with the tropical moisture into what would later be called the Perfect Storm.
In 2010, flooding from hurricane Tomas worsened a cholera epidemic that was taking place in Haiti at the time.
In 2015 moisture from Hurricane Joaquin, which was raging out in the Atlantic, fed into another storm over the eastern U.S. and contributed to catastrophic flooding in South Carolina

Hurricanes are neither cause by humans nor geological in nature. Hurricanes are meteorological. In other words, they are weather. Geology is the study of the rocks and sediments that make up the Earth. A hurricane is a powerful storm that develops from atmospheric processes, which makes it a form of weather.
